Religion transcends national boarders and most religions including Christian faiths, Islam, Judaism, Buddhism, Hinduism and more regularly invite learned elders of their religions to join them in the UK for payer and guidance. Young religious people are also invited to extend their understanding of the UK and our people. The new laws to restrict Ministers of religion coming the UK will affect every religion in the UK.

For a minister of religion to enter the UK currently they simply require a letter of invitation from the congregation(s) they wish to visit. Going forward they will require a pre-approved Government sponsor who has paid for their approval. The new laws allow the Home Office to refuse the minister of religion the right to come to the UK as they do not have a pre-approved sponsor.
